Materials and decoration of a small nursery

Materials for any children's room should be chosen with special care. Firstly, they must be environmentally friendly and not emit harmful substances, synthetic odors, and secondly, to be resistant to mechanical damage. In addition, aesthetic appearance and affordable price are no less important.

Floor

In a small nursery it is very desirable to have a heated floor. Wooden parquet is suitable for coverings, quality laminate, Cork tree. For babies who are just learning to walk, a soft carpet or carpet tiles will be indispensable.

It is better to avoid linoleum and fashionable self-leveling options - it is solid plastic, and besides, it is very slippery. In general, you shouldn’t make too smooth hard floors in such rooms: one careless movement can lead to injury, but children love to jump, run, dance and fool around all the time.

Walls

To make a small room seem more spacious, the walls should be light and discreet. This could be painting, wallpaper (except vinyl - they do not allow the walls to breathe and sometimes even cause allergic reactions), decorative plaster. Small, elegant patterns, thin stripes, photo wallpapers with perspective or a 3D effect are allowed.

It makes sense to leave one of the walls or part of it under children's creativity. A slate surface (board or special paint) is perfect for drawing with chalk. You can also buy paper wallpaper-coloring books, which will provide your child with interesting leisure time for a long time.

Ceiling

For finishing the ceiling in a small nursery, light whitewash is optimal. To forget about cracks and crumbling plaster for 20-30 years, paint can be applied over painting fiberglass.

If you need volume, then a two-level plasterboard structure will fit perfectly here. Glossy materials will help make the room visually taller suspended ceiling, as well as upward-facing lighting.

Textile

Fabrics used in the baby's room should be hypoallergenic and collect as little dust as possible. Thin tulle, linen or cotton are suitable for curtains. You can also use bamboo blinds and Roman shades.

When choosing bed linen, it is advisable to focus on dim colors that harmoniously match the interior. Textiles in contact with skin must comply sanitary standards, no chemical smell and no shedding. It must contain completely natural fibers.

Proper lighting in the nursery

The room in which the child spends a lot of time must be well lit. This affects not only general atmosphere, making the room cozy and welcoming, but also visually appealing.

The soft, diffused light of LED bulbs (light emitting diodes) in the white and yellow spectrum is best perceived. In second place in terms of safety are incandescent lamps. According to researchers, they are as close as possible in the type of radiation to sunlight. Bright neon colors can irritate the eyes and fluorescent lamps daylight (containing mercury) are generally not recommended for use at home, especially in a nursery.

As for lamps, in a small children's room you should give preference to spot options, placing them along the entire ceiling. In the center you can hang a small chandelier, for example, in the form of a ball, bell, butterfly. A compact sconce would not hurt on the wall near the bed, and would be ideal for a work area desk lamp or directional pendant.

What household appliances should you choose to make your small kitchen functional?

The practical interior of a small kitchen includes specific household appliances. For example, it is recommended to choose a multi-function device instead of several devices with one function: food processor instead of a blender, juicer and chopper. If the apartment belongs to a small family, then you should choose a hob with two burners instead of a model with four.

Small kitchen - suitable premises for reduced size equipment. For example, a huge refrigerator is often empty. An excellent option that will fit into the interior of a small kitchen is a compact kitchen refrigerator. To make the room more functional, you can hang a piece of furniture above it: a cabinet or shelf.

Any small kitchen design project in the photo has a characteristic feature. It is easy to notice that the modern design of a small kitchen involves placing the refrigerator in the corner of the room. This makes the kitchen environment look more harmonious. An important point is how the refrigerator door opens. It should be oriented so that in the open position it is as close to the wall as possible. This way the kitchen will benefit from convenience. When choosing a location for the refrigerator, it is worth considering the rule of the working triangle. The storage area, including the refrigerator, the washing area and the cooking area are the vertices of the triangle, the distance between which should be in the range from 0.7 to 2.5 m. The working kitchen triangle allows you to use the space rationally. The owner is less tired because she has to overcome minimum distances between the required zones.

A small kitchen with limited space dictates the need to search for non-trivial ideas. You can save space by integrating equipment into furniture. But if installing household appliances seems expensive, then try placing them on brackets. An obvious example is to use brackets to accommodate microwave oven on the wall.

Redevelopment that will make a small kitchen larger

An apartment with an unsuccessful layout is not a death sentence. After legal approval, the layout can be corrected, and the small kitchen will become larger. The size of the room is increased by combining it with a balcony or living room. Arrangement of a common space with a balcony requires careful weighing of the pros and cons, since its approval by government agencies is problematic. If all formalities are successfully completed, a dining area is set up on the balcony, a refrigerator or storage systems are placed. The balcony will have to not only be glazed, but also thoroughly insulated.

If the idea of ​​combining with a balcony does not appeal, then combining it with the living room is carried out. This will allow you to create a full-fledged dining area, and the living room will also become a dining room. If a small kitchen is combined with a living room, then a single design is necessary for them. But the area where the kitchen is located should be separated from the living room. For example, using lamps hanging from the ceiling, different floor or wall finishes.

Don't want your apartment to change its layout? Try less radical ways. A small kitchen can be expanded if you abandon standard hinged doors. They will be replaced by sliding doors. This way you can rationally use the space next to them. To completely abandon doors is not best idea, since such actions are prohibited by law.
